Watch Lil Duval: Living My Best Life Full Movies Free HD Online on 123Movies Alternative Sites | MegaMads.tv

If you get any error message when trying to stream, please Refresh the page or switch to another streaming server.
Watch Lil Duval: Living My Best Life Full Movies Free HD Online 123Movies Alternative Sites | MegaMads.tv

Lil Duval: Living My Best Life

Duval takes an intimate and hilarious look at life, sex, relationships and more.

Watch Lil Duval: Living My Best Life Online Free

Lil Duval: Living My Best Life Online Free

Where to watch Lil Duval: Living My Best Life

Lil Duval: Living My Best Life movie free online

Lil Duval: Living My Best Life free online